Jammu & Kashmir's Umran Malik To Soon Join Indian T20 World Cup Team
Umran Malik of Jammu & Kashmir has been selected as India's net bowler for the Forthcoming T20 World Cup. In the IPL 2021, Malik played for SunRisers Hyderabad, setting a record for the fastest delivery at 153 kph in the season against Royal Challengers Bangalore on October 6. Malik accomplished this milestone against Devdutt Padikkal on the fourth delivery of the ninth over.

Gavaskar Backs Rohit Sharma As Captain For Two T20 World Cups
Before any official announcement by BCCI for India's next T20 World Cup Captain, Veteran Indian cricketer Sunil Gavaskar opined that Rohit Sharma should replace Virat Kohli in the next two T20 World Cups. Notably, Kohli will discontinue the captaincy of the T20 Squad after the World Cup which will be held in UAE and Oman in October-November. ''Rohit Sharma would definitely be my choice,'' said Gavaskar.

Virat Kohli To Resign As RCB Captain After 2021 IPL
Indian batting ace Virat Kohli said on September 19 that he is planning to resign as the captain of Royal-Challengers Bangalore at the end of the current IPL season. The news comes after opting to leave the Indian T20 captaincy following the World Cup in October. Upon announcing his resignation as the captain of the Indian T20 team, he claimed that he was doing so to manage his workload well.

ACB Appoints Mohammed Nabi As Afghanistan Men's cricket Captain
Cricket All-Rounder Mohammed Nabi will now be leading the Afghanistan men's Cricket team in the upcoming T20 World Cup, as its new captain. The decision comes on September 9, after former captain Rashid Khan decides to step down from his post. Reportedly, Khan said, "The selection committee and ACB has not obtained my consent for the team which has been announced by ACB media.”

ICC T20 World Cup: India To Face Pakistan After 5 Years
The T20 Cricket World Cup will be held in Oman and UAE between October 17 and November 14, 2021, as announced by the ICC. The ICC announced the schedule on August 17 that features all-time rivals India and Pakistan who will face each other after five years on October 24 in Dubai. Both the teams have reached the Super 12 stage which also includes Afghanistan and New Zealand.

BCCI To Resume Remaining VIVO IPL 2021 Matches In UAE
In a virtual meeting held on May 29, the Board of Control for Cricket in India (BCCI) has decided to conduct the remaining VIVO Indian Premier League 2021 season in UAE. As per BCCI, the decision was taken considering the September-October monsoon season in India. For the same, BCCI also asked the concerned authorities to approach ICC seeking an extension of the T20 World Cup 2021 scheduled in October.
